The Yogavasistha is a Hindu spiritual text written by Valmiki (who also authored the Ramayana) dealing with the philosophical topics from the Advaita-vedanta school. Chronologically it precedes the Ramayana.

Verse 4.19.33

अनाक्रान्तेन्द्रियच्छिद्रो यतः क्षुब्धोऽन्तरेव सः ।
संविदानुभवत्याशु स स्वप्न इति कथ्यते ॥ ३३ ॥

anākrāntendriyacchidro yataḥ kṣubdho'ntareva saḥ |
saṃvidānubhavatyāśu sa svapna iti kathyate || 33 ||

When the organs are not besieged by external objects, which disturb the inward senses of the mind; it indulges itself in the reflection of many things, which is called its dreaming state.
